Preventing Backflow : A Crucial Element in Plumbing

Backflow prevention is critical to maintaining healthy water systems. It involves preventing the reverse flow of dirty water back into the freshwater supply. Lacking proper backflow prevention measures can lead to a range of problems, such as health hazards and damage to homes.

Backflow can occur when there is a pressure difference between the potable water supply and the dirty water system. This can happen during maintenance, or if there are malfunctioning valves or pipes.

For prevent backflow, it is crucial to install flow restrictors that act as a barrier between the two systems. These devices are designed to permit water flow in one direction only, and promptly seal when the flow goes backward.

Variations of Backflow Preventer Systems Explained

Backflow preventers play a crucial role in safeguarding your plumbing system from contamination. These ingenious devices stop the unwanted reverse flow of water, ensuring that clean water remains separate from potentially hazardous substances. There are several types of backflow preventers available, each designed to handle specific cases.

  • Dual Check Assembly: This standard type utilizes two valves that function in tandem to effectively prevent backflow.
  • Vacuum Relief Valve: This basic device releases when a pressure difference occurs, expelling any potential contamination back into the main water line.
  • Swing Check Valve: This reliable valve utilizes a ball or disk that rotates to block reverse flow.
  • RPZ Assembly: This advanced assembly is commonly used in commercial settings, providing a high level of protection against backflow.

Picking the right type of backflow preventer relies on factors such as the application, water pressure, and potential contaminants present. It's essential to speak with a qualified plumbing professional to figure out the most appropriate backflow prevention solution for your needs.
